Direkt zum Inhalt
  • Agentur für web development
  • Content Management mit Primer
  • Open Source Leadership mit Drupal
    Sprache
  • Deutsch
  • English
  • Kontakt
Logo der Website
Agentur für Webentwicklung
  • Referenzen
  • Angebot
  • Aktuelles
  • Über uns
  • Agentur für web development
  • Content Management mit Primer
  • Open Source Leadership mit Drupal
close
×

Info message

This content has not been translated to Deutsch yet. You are reading the English version.

Blog Number 1: First Month

15. August 2014

I’ve been working at MD Systems as an intern for a month now, It’s amazing how fast time flies by and you don’t even realise it.

This blogpost is part of the on-going MD Systems Drupal 8 Internships. In these Blogs the students report monthly about their experience with Drupal 8, the development work they do and the cooperation with our Team...

christian-broekmeulen.jpg

In my first month alone I’ve attended to Drupal 8 Media Community Sprint week, joined my first SCRUM meeting, ported a module to Drupal 8, contributed to several modules, contributed to core and I did a lot more. With porting I mean modifying an old release of a Drupal module (in this case Drupal 7) to work with Drupal 8.

First assignment

Together with a fellow intern our assignment was to finish the partially done Drupal 8 port of the Saferpay Module and integrate it with the Payment Module. While working on Saferpay for a few days we stumbled on an integration problem, after some research there was a management decision to switch from Saferpay to Datatrans.

Datatrans

Datatrans was only released in Drupal 7, this meant we had to port it to Drupal 8. We did this by starting a new module from scratch and implementing all existing features one by one. We could’ve also modified the existing module step by step but as Datatrans was not a large module we decided to start from scratch as this gave us a good overview what exactly was done and what had to be done. After we finished porting Datatrans my first Drupal 8 community sprint week started.
Media Sprint week

Every few weeks MD-Systems opens their doors to sprint for a new Drupal 8 Contrib topic. And so they did on the 21th of July. The whole week we would work on Media and related modules with other participants. I mainly worked on Media Entity, my main tasks were to solve open issues, provide Views integration for media items and create tests for new functionality.
As of Drupal 8, Views has been incorporated into Drupal Core. Learn more about Views in Drupal 8.

Back to the daily routine

After having a successful sprint it was time to move forward and return to the daily routine.
For me this meant working on my next assignment File Entity. File Entity was partially ported to Drupal 8 and my tasks were to create a multi steps, entity edit and configurable fields forms, implement basic routing, menu links and local tasks, improve files view and last but not least provide complete test coverage for these added features using SimpleTest.


At the time of writing this I’m working on a bigger project, you’ll be able to read more about this on my next blog which will be due next month. Don’t forget to follow my recent activity on Drupal.org

Unser Engagement für Barrierefreiheit und Inklusion mit der ADIS

12. September 2025

MD Systems treibt in der Allianz Digitale Inklusion Schweiz (ADIS) verbindliche Standards und Bildungsformate voran, damit barrierefreie Lösungen selbstverständlich werden. Konkrete Ergebnisse statt Absichtserklärungen.

Mehr lesen

Warum Open Source Kollaboration Teil der Ausbildung sein muss

Menschen halten sich an den Händen
4. September 2025

MD Systems zeigt, wie die Lehrlingsbildung der Zukunft aussieht: Offene Ökosysteme und Open Source-Kollaboration erweitern klassische Lehrgänge – für mehr Potential bei Lernenden, mehr Nutzen für Unternehmen und einen Schub für die gesellschaftliche Transformation.

Mehr lesen

25 Jahre MD Systems, das Interview

Miro & Sascha
11. Juli 2025

25 Jahre MD Systems und es gibt so einiges zu erzählen. Miro Dietiker und Sascha Grossenbacher nehmen Stellung zu kritischen Fragen und geben einen Rückblick auf 25 Jahre Open Source.

Mehr lesen

Hol Dir den Newsletter

Jetzt für unseren Newsletter anmelden und monatlich wichtige Insights aus der Branche und MD Systems erhalten. 

Zur Anmeldung

Über MD Systems

MD Systems mit Firmensitz Zürich ist ein einzigartiges Team von internationalen Open Source Initiative Leadern für das Content Management System Drupal.

Wir begleiten Sie von der Idee und Konzeption über die Realisation bis hin zur Einführung, Betrieb und laufenden Optimierung.

MD Systems GmbH

Hermetschloostrasse 77, CH-8048 Zürich

Schweiz

+41 44 500 45 95

[email protected]

  • Kontakt
  • Impressum
  • Datenschutz
To top

© Copyright 2023 - 2024 MD Systems GmbH. Alle Rechte vorbehalten. Erstellt mit PRIMER - powered by Drupal.